SUMMARY:Women Artists: Four Centuries of Creativity
DESCRIPTION:Art works on loan from The Reading Public Museum Collection\nMarch 18\nExhibition opens on March 18 during normal Museum hours (12pm – 5pm). This exhibition represents four centuries of art created by remarkable women who struggled against gender bias to take their places in history. Until the twentieth century\, women were often had difficulty showing and selling their work. \nThis exhibition will be on view until May 30
